Mvvm 剑道UI:无法将ViewModel绑定到主体或主容器div

Mvvm 剑道UI:无法将ViewModel绑定到主体或主容器div,mvvm,kendo-ui,kendo-grid,Mvvm,Kendo Ui,Kendo Grid,我有一个页面,它由一个拆分器、一个网格、一个表单和一个自动完成组成 现在我已经创建了一个视图模型并将其绑定到网格。。。数据绑定成功:- kendo.bind($("#grid"), viewModel); //**Runs well** 但是, kendo.bind(document.body, viewModel); // **This doesn't** 当我尝试将视图模型绑定到主体或主容器div(包装器)时,网格将从页面中消失,其他一些字段也会消失 基本上,我想要实现的是将一个对象(网

我有一个页面,它由一个拆分器、一个网格、一个表单和一个自动完成组成

现在我已经创建了一个视图模型并将其绑定到网格。。。数据绑定成功:-

kendo.bind($("#grid"), viewModel); //**Runs well**
但是,

kendo.bind(document.body, viewModel); // **This doesn't**
当我尝试将视图模型绑定到主体或主容器div(包装器)时,网格将从页面中消失,其他一些字段也会消失

基本上,我想要实现的是将一个对象(网格行详细信息)从一个视图模型传递到另一个视图模型(即表单)。因此,我没有这样做,而是考虑将完整的视图模型绑定到主体

你能告诉我哪里出了问题吗

谢谢


Hardik

使用此语法绑定网格的视图模型


kendo.bind(document.body.children,viewModel)

在您出示完整页面之前,我们无法告诉您任何事情。理想情况下是jsbin或JSFIDLE示例。是的…JU将准备一个示例并上传到那里。。。谢谢你的反馈!!:)嗯…很有趣。。。我可以将视图模型绑定到JSBin中的主体,但不能绑定到我的页面上。然而,我创建的示例有两个视图模型:网格和表单。。如何将当前记录的详细信息传递给第二个视图模型?您好,我最终可以通过创建表单模板来解决此问题,该模板将在选择网格行时自动更新…感谢您回答我的问题!!然而,只有一个问题。。在网格的dataBound事件中,当页面加载时,如何保持默认选中的第一行??